Extreme Heat Alert

Posted on Monday, June 23, 2025 01:56 PM

From the Renfrew County and District Health Unit

For Immediate Release
(Pembroke, Ontario, June 21, 2025)

Environment Canada has issued a heat warning for all of Renfrew County and District. A significant heat event with dangerously hot and humid conditions will begin Sunday afternoon and is expected to continue until at least Tuesday. MUNICIPAL WATER USE RESTRICTIONS

Posted on Thursday, May 15, 2025 06:00 AM

The Township of Laurentian Valley’s Water Restriction Bylaw takes effect May 15th and lasts through September 15, 2025, for users of the Municipal Water System.
Watering lawns and gardens is allowed only between the hours of 6:00 A.M. to 10:00 A.M. and 6:00 P.M. to 10:00 P.M.

  • Residents occupying an EVEN numbered address may water on EVEN numbered calendar days only (e.g. 2, 4, 6).
  • Residents occupying an ODD numbered address may water on ODD numbered calendar days only (e.g. 1, 3, 5).
